 ​What Are Thermofoil Shaker Cabinets?​

Thermofoil Shaker cabinets feature a ​medium-density fiberboard (MDF) core​ wrapped in a seamless, heat-bonded vinyl film. This process creates a smooth, painted-wood appearance while retaining the ​Shaker style's hallmark simplicity: a five-panel door with clean lines, recessed centers, and squared edges. Unlike traditional wood, thermofoil delivers uniformity in color and texture-ideal for modern and transitional kitchens.

 ​Key Advantages

Cost-Effectiveness

Priced at ​​750–1,200 for an average kitchen​ (vs. 5,000–25,000 for solid wood). Ideal for remodels prioritizing style on a budget.

Durability & Resistance

Vinyl film​ shields cabinets from:

Moisture (prevents swelling in humid kitchens/bathrooms).

Stains (non-porous surface repels spills).

Fading (UV-resistant finishes retain color for 10–15 years).

Design Consistency

No wood-grain variations-perfect for achieving a ​monolithic, high-end look​.

Low Maintenance

Clean with ​damp cloth + mild detergent; no polishing or refinishing needed.

Eco-Friendly Option

Uses engineered wood cores (reduces deforestation vs. solid wood).

 

 ​Potential Drawbacks

Heat Sensitivity

Prolonged exposure to >150°F (e.g., near ovens) may cause ​delamination.

Fix: Use heat shields or maintain 12" clearance from heat sources.

Irreversible Damage

Deep scratches or chips expose MDF, which ​cannot be sanded/repaired​ like wood.

Solution: Apply vinyl repair kits for minor flaws.

Limited Custom Depth

Thinner MDF cores may sag under >50 lbs/shelf.

Reinforcement: Add steel brackets for heavy dishware.

🪵 ​1. Material Composition & Manufacturing

Thermofoil Cabinets:

Made by ​heat-fusing a PVC vinyl film​ onto an ​MDF (Medium-Density Fiberboard) core​ .

Seamless, non-porous surface; no natural grain variations.

Maple Cabinets:

Crafted from ​solid hardwood​ (e.g., rock maple or sugar maple) .

Features natural wood grains, knots, and color variations; often finished with stains or lacquers.

 

 ​2. Aesthetics & Design Flexibility

Aspect Thermofoil Maple
Finish Glossy/matte solid colors or wood-grain prints; uniform appearance . Natural wood grains; accepts stains/paints for custom looks (e.g., cherry, espresso) .
Style Suitability Modern, minimalist kitchens; ideal for monochromatic themes. Traditional, farmhouse, or luxury kitchens; timeless appeal .
Texture Smooth, plastic-like feel; lacks depth. Tactile wood grain; warm, organic texture.

 

 ​3. Durability & Performance

Factor Thermofoil Maple
Heat Resistance Vulnerable to delamination above 150°F (e.g., near ovens); bubbles/peels under heat stress . Highly heat-resistant; solid wood withstands high temperatures without damage.
Moisture Resistance Non-porous; resists spills and humidity but ​seams can trap water, causing MDF swelling . Prone to warping in humid environments unless sealed with polyurethane .
Scratch/Impact Surface scratches easily; irreparable if film tears (exposes MDF) . Scratches can be sanded and refinished; durable against dents .
Lifespan 10–15 years (premium); 5–8 years (budget) . 25–30+ years with proper maintenance; ages gracefully .

 ​5. Maintenance & Repairs

Thermofoil:

Cleaning: Wipe with mild soap/water; avoid abrasives .

Repairs: Minor flaws fixed with vinyl patches; severe damage requires door replacement.

Maple:

Cleaning: Dust regularly; use wood polish annually.

Repairs: Sand and refinish scratches; warped doors can be rehung.
